Recognizing Various Kinds Of Refractive Surgery
When you're considering refractive surgical treatment, it's necessary to recognize the different kinds readily available.
One of the most typical options include LASIK, PRK, and LASEK.
LASIK makes use of a laser to improve the cornea, offering quick healing and very little discomfort.
PRK, on the other hand, gets rid of the external layer of the cornea prior to improving it, which can be helpful for those with thinner corneas but may entail a longer healing procedure.
LASEK integrates components of both LASIK and PRK, protecting the corneal flap while improving the underlying tissue.
Each surgical treatment has its advantages and disadvantages, so it is essential to go over these options with your eye treatment expert.
